Job Details

Job Title

Pharmacy Technician

Location

Olympia, WA

Schedule / Job Type

Contract | Evening Shift | 5x8 Hours | 3:00 PM – 11:30 PM

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form pharmacy technician duties within a short-term acute care inpatient hospital setting
  • Support the pharmacy department during evening shift operations
  • Accurately process and dispense medications in accordance with facility protocols
  • Utilize EPIC electronic health records system for documentation and order management
  • Collaborate with pharmacy staff and clinical teams to ensure safe and efficient medication delivery

Required Qualifications

  • Certified Pharmacy Technician (CPhT) certification required
  • Minimum of 1 year of inpatient hospital pharmacy experience
  • Proficiency with EPIC charting system
  • Candidates must not have a permanent residence within 50 miles of the facility to be eligible for a travel contract
  • All requested time off must be disclosed at time of submittal

Preferred Experience / Skills

  • Prior experience in a short-term acute care hospital environment
  • Familiarity with travel contract compliance requirements and onboarding processes
